About this home

This beautiful lot contains 2.81 acres on the lake - build your dream home here. The lake is aerated and wildlife abounds in this subdivision. Horses are allowed and welcomed here. Walking paths throughout the subdivision and access road to the James River for a day of sunbathing, swimming or fishing. This whole subdivision is magnificent.

What's nearby

Fort Boykin sits just 0.7 miles away — a historic earthwork fort turned public park right on the James River, and genuinely one of the more underrated green spaces in the region. It's the kind of place you'll walk to on a weekend morning and feel like you have it to yourself. Beyond the immediate area, downtown Smithfield is a short drive for locally owned restaurants, a farmers market, and everyday errands. Joint Base Langley-Eustis is roughly 17 minutes out, and Naval Weapons Station Yorktown is about 29 minutes — keeping two major installations within a reasonable commute window.
